FDA Says Adderall Drug Data Isn't Enough for Recall (Update1)
U.S. drug safety reports linking an attention deficit drug to 20
deaths aren't enough for the Food and Drug Administration to follow
Canada in taking the product off the market, the agency's director of
medical policy said today.
Health Canada ordered the withdrawal yesterday of Adderall XR, made by
Shire Pharmaceuticals Group Plc, based on its review of adverse-event
reports previously given to the U.S. agency by the Basingstoke,
England-based company.
The drug is prescribed for children and adults with attention deficit
hyperactivity disorder.
